Brown Mackie College – Fort Wayne Is Hosting Public Open House On Saturday, September 22nd


(FORT WAYNE, IN – September 19, 2012)    To commemorate the Brown Mackie College system of school’s 120th anniversary of educating students; Brown Mackie College – Fort Wayne  (“Brown Mackie College”) will open its doors to the Fort Wayne and surrounding community to join the celebration on Saturday, September 22, 2012, from 10 am – 2 pm at the school on 3000 East Coliseum Blvd., Suite 100 in Fort Wayne.  All Brown Mackie College current and former faculty, staff, students and the community are invited to enjoy the school’s 120th anniversary party.

Prospective students attending the open house will have the opportunity to tour the school and meet with various faculty and staff to learn about admissions, financial aid (available to those who qualify), career service, and details about programs offered. Students will also learn more about Brown Mackie College’s partnership with Apple Inc. to introduce the iPad and eTextbooks to its students. The college is now converting to 100 percent electronic textbooks (eTextbooks), and the iPad is the vehicle for delivering that technology.

The Brown Mackie College system of schools is dedicated to providing educational programs that prepare students for entry-level positions in a competitive, rapidly changing workplace. Brown Mackie College offers bachelor’s degree, associate degree, certificate and diploma programs in health sciences, business, information technology, legal studies and design technologies. The Brown Mackie College schools established a unique “one course a month” scheduling format that allows students to focus on one subject for one month, then move on to the next. Courses are offered during days and evenings.

Brown Mackie College was founded and approved by the Board of Trustees of Kansas Wesleyan College in Salina, Kansas on July 30, 1892. In 1938, the College was incorporated as The Brown Mackie School of Business under the ownership of Mr. Perry E. Brown and Mr. A.B. Mackie, former instructors at Kansas Wesleyan University in Salina, Kansas. With improvements in curricula and higher degree-granting status, in 1975 The Brown Mackie School of Business became Brown Mackie College. In 2003, the College was acquired by Education Management Corporation.
